In other moves reported by the AP that are expected to be made official this week: Dallas acquired cornerback Stephon Gilmore from Indianapol­is for a fifth-round pick and agreed to a three-year, $24-million deal with safety Donovan Wilson and a two-year deal with linebacker Leighton Vander

Esch . ... Minnesota reached an agreement with quarterbac­k Kirk

Cousins to change bonus language in his existing contract that cleared $16 million from their salary cap . ... New Orleans receiver

Michael Thomas agreed to a oneyear, incentive-laden contract worth between $10 million and $15 million . ... Detroit agreed with running back David Montgomery on a three-year, $18-million contract and cornerback Emmanuel

Moseley on a one-year, $6-million deal . ... Miami is bringing back running backs Raheem Mostert and

Jeff Wilson Jr., agreeing on twoyear contracts for both players . ... ... Philadelph­ia agreed to a threeyear, $38-million contract with cornerback James Bradberry and a contract with running back

Rashaad Penny . ... ... Seattle released veteran defensive linemen

Shelby Harris and Quinton Jefferson and agreed to a two-year contract with defensive tackle Jarran Reed .. ... San Francisco agreed to a contract extension with starting center Jake Brendel . ... Chicago agreed to a contract with former Tennessee defensive end DeMarcus Walker . ... Andrew Wingard agreed to return to Jacksonvil­le on a three-year, $9.6-million contract . ... Houston agreed to send Tampa Bay a sixth-round draft pick for guard Shaq Mason and a seventh-round pick . ... Cleveland will re-sign linebacker Sione

Takitaki.
